With all the getaway break coming up, you’re probably getting excited about investing quality time with family and friends. However in the lack of homework projects and classwork, it is possible to carve down some time to keep on track along with your college admissions prepare.

Preferably, high school seniors have previously completed their university applications before winter break — but not everyone does that.

‚i recommend seniors finish their applications before the holidays because high schools and colleges slow down, and if there is a nagging issue, it can be more difficult to fix through the break,‘ explains Mandee Heller Adler, creator of Global College Counselors in Fort Lauderdale, Florida.

For more youthful students, Adler has these tips to make many regarding the break between semesters: ‚Juniors can use part of their time off during winter break to review for the SAT or ACT, and ninth graders and sophomores can begin considering summer programs, get ahead on their coursework, and I recommend they read books for pleasure, which will help using their SAT and ACT preparation,‘ she claims.

In accordance with Sharon Genicoff, a college counselor at Bergen County Technical High School in Teterboro, N.J., and co-founder of upcoming Generation asking, this is how seniors may use the full time during holiday break to check admissions that are important away from their lists:

1. Do not assume counselors are checking e-mail over the wintertime break: Before you leave for winter break, confer with your college counselor about your approaching application deadlines. They may want to send your transcripts and letters of recommendation ahead of time if you have a Jan. 1 paper writer deadline. If instructors deliver letters of suggestions, register with them too.

Forward your test scores through the state assessment agency web site: should you have a Jan. 1 due date, cannot wait to submit your test ratings as it can certainly use up to a couple of weeks for colleges to receive scores. Additionally, determine in the event that schools where you are using will accept scores that are self-reported as this may save some funds.

Ensure that your applications reflect any changes: plenty could have occurred since September — perchance you dropped a class, attained honor roll very first marking period, had been inducted into National Honor community or joined up with a club that is new. Review what you have actually formerly noted on the application and work out any updates that are necessary.

4. Avoid any ’surprise‘ supplemental essays: If you left essays for the minute that is last the time has come to complete them. Frequently, students compose their statement that is personal essays and neglect the supplemental essays for every organization. But, this is one way many universities determine if you’re a fit for their college community and whether you have got done your quest about what means they are ‚them‘ and you also ‚you.“ regarding the Common Application, supplemental essays are going to be found in the Member Questions section, but might not be visible until such time you suggest your scholastic market. Avoid any shocks and complete your concerns as soon as possible in order to anticipate the essays you’ve got left to publish.

5. Make improvements to essays: you have put your best work forward if you did write your essays, take one last look to make sure. This means proofreading and editing. Perchance you visited an university campus within the last few couple weeks along with a brand new viewpoint as to why you intend to go to that institution — add this to your essay! Lastly, if you haven’t done so, share one or two trusted mentors to your essays. Don’t over edit or higher share your essays — at the end of this day, you need each essay to mirror your sound, not another person’s.

6. Complete the FAFSA and CSS Profile if needed: It may be difficult to sit down as a family members to complete the FAFSA/CSS through the school year because most people are therefore busy. Produce a intend to sit together as a household throughout the vacation break and complete the documents that are financial for the organizations where you are using.

7. Submit before Dec. 31: Don’t spend your brand-new Year’s Eve submitting applications! Offer yourself a couple of days because it is unlikely colleges will be answering their phones on New Year’s Eve or Day if you do have any issues submitting an application. In fact, most colleges will close because of their own holiday breaks so be sure you have actually all relevant questions answered before Christmas Eve.

Getting A Parent’s Role into the College Application Process

 
 

It’s not news to anyone that the faculty application procedure could be a stressful one, but it’s something parents may be especially conscious of. Family could be the biggest cheerleaders for the young young ones inside their life going right through the procedure, but often they don’t know how — or just how much — to be involved.

Parents usually hold back on the admission process or feel that applying to college is an important rite of passage that students do all on their own because they feel shaky themselves. Other people feel their best part is to act as hand-holder or drill sergeant, putting their kids through their college application paces.

I am right here to tell you there is (happily) a medium that is happy. Parents along with other family members can be quite a huge help to students by offering both ethical and logistical help in tackling that long listing of college application tasks. Build-up morale by providing to simply take your youngster on college tours and to visit university fairs. Assist them research and compare colleges. You shouldn’t be afraid to inquire of lots of questions.

In terms of university conversations, my six biggest tips are the following:

1. Set some ground guidelines. Moms and dads must get their very own university worries in balance before broaching these weighty topics with students. You would like conversations become productive and positive. Your kids are likely to simply take their cues away from you about how to approach the college admission procedure. It’s not necessary to be perfect, nevertheless when you sense yourself losing your perspective, return back to setting examples that are good.

2. Start early. This is the most popular word of advice written by parents who have been through the procedure. (About 50 percent of participants to our College that is annual Hopes Worries survey say this). Planning ahead won’t just set your child up to achieve success, it will can even make the process plenty less stressful.

3. Assist students find balance. It’s possible to be too focused on getting into college. Most of us want our kids and pupils to worry about their futures. But it will look to colleges, they’re trying to game the system rather than follow their own interests if they make every decision based on how. That never works in university admissions, and it does not lead to a delighted, confident kid, either. Help your student college that is separate from other areas of these everyday lives while additionally getting a stability between your two.

4. Develop a rock-solid support system. There’s a good explanation you do not ask your doctor to do your fees or your accountant to diagnose your leg pain. Go directly to the sources that are right. Your son or daughter’s senior school counselor, universities‘ websites, college guidebooks, admission officers, representatives at college fairs and pupils whom attend the educational schools are good sources.

5. Help your child find out the school atmosphere that may let them flourish — academically, really, socially and economically. This all extends back to ‚best fit colleges,‘ that I discuss at length in The very best 385 Colleges. You are looking for the schools that will fit your student to a T. You realize your child well but be patient as they work through the journey. Communicate your views but be open to negotiating and compromising. That said, do talk about finances and university costs early, and make yes a safety that is financial helps it be on their list.
